Frankfurt, one of the most important cities in Europe since the Middle Ages, was also one of the administrative centers of the Holy Roman-German Empire. It is possible to see activity in the city, which hosts thousands of people with its world-famous fairs, financial centers, shopping centers and historical streets.

The city, which the Germans call 'Frankfurt am Main' to distinguish it from the small Frankfurt in the state of Brandenburg, is the 5th most populous city in the country. The city, where the European Central Bank is also located, is considered the most important financial center of the continent.

Frankfurt Attractions

Located on the Main River, one of the largest branches of the Rhine, Frankfurt offers a pleasant experience to the visitors of the city with its attractions. The city, the birthplace of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, draws attention with its more than 100 skyscrapers and high-rise buildings.

These buildings lined up around the Main River, lush parks and meadows, bridges connecting the two sides of the river, and the natural beauties of the city provide a visual feast. The city, which is the representative of a modern world, is not in a gray color contrary to popular belief. Everywhere is full of large parks dominated by green tones.

Harmony and synthesis affect people in the city where contemporary and traditional buildings coexist. Many galleries and museums make a positive contribution to the art life of the city, as the income generated by the financial centers is transformed into art.

Goethe's House (Goethe-Haus) is one of the most visited places in the city. In the house where Goethe lived with his parents, there are belongings, objects and photographs of him.

The Cathedral, whose history dates back to 850 years, is in Domplatz. It is possible to visit the museum in this tower, which is open from April to October in the church, which is a magnificent structure with its 95-meter tower.

The 600-year-old town hall, Römer, has a medieval feel. The 260-meter-high Commerzbank Tower, which is the tallest building in Europe, is among the symbols of the city. In addition to the Commerzbank Tower, Deutsche Bank's two towers, the 256-meter Messeturm (Exhibition Tower) and the Silver (silver) Tower, can also be included in the list of places to see.

Frankfurt Zoo, one of the oldest zoos in the world and founded in 1858, has 4,500 animals from 500 different species. This place, especially preferred by families with children, has a chirpy appearance.

The boutique museums lined up along both sides of the Main River attract the attention of art lovers. Giersch Museum, Museum of Applied Art, Museum of Communication, Museum of World Cultures are among the museums that can be seen in this region.
